Blokchain accelerator program to include help from Amazon, Deloitte, Fidelity and more, launched by IDEO CoLab

  • IDEO to partnership with big blue chip and crypto firms, as they look to provide resources to the community.
  • The subsidiary IDEO gives users access to tools and funding for their innovation with blockchain. 

 

IDEO CoLab, a subsidiary of design firm IDEO, has announced partnering up with 20 blue chip and crypto firms to ready launching a blockchain accelerator dubbed Startup Studio.

In terms of the big house-hold names as part of the collaboration include the likes of; Amazon, Deloitte and Fidelity. On the crypto side, data firm Messari, the Ethereum Foundation, the Stellar Foundation, plus many more.

All involved will be set to contribute in the building of the distributed web incubator that IDEO CoLab launched in February.

Partners will be hosting acceleration programs to provide enterprising blockchain entrepreneurs and firms with required resources of; tools and funding they need to further the “development, adoption, and impact of blockchain technology.
